Transcend JetFlash T3 Goes Black

Transcend has launched a new Black version of its ultra-compact USB flash drive, the JetFlash T3.

Measuring only 30.3mm x 12.3mm x 2.4mm (L x W x D), the new T3 weighs just 2g, and is more solid and robust compared to other miniature USB flash drives as well as full-sized flash drives, the company claims.

This solid durability is the result of Transcend's COB (Chip On Board) manufacturing technique that molds the flash memory chip and circuit board into the driver's unbreakable polycarbonate casing.

The T3 is made with brand-name NAND Flash chips, and can be directly plugged into any USB slot - no adapter required.

In addition, users can download JetFlash Elite data management tools to enjoy security features such as auto-login, PC-lock, secret-zip, and e-mail data backup.

The drive is compatible with Windows Me/2000/XP/Vista, Mac OS 9.0/OS X and Linux Kernel 2.4.2 or later.

Transcend's JetFlash T3 1GB is available for a price of Rs 700 from Mediaman Infotech and Supertron Electronics.
